front is 9,5 x 19 265 30 19 Off 27.. no problem and you could maybe go to off 25
rear is 10,5 x 19 295 30 19 off 50.. just on realy hard bumps with a lot of speeds it rubs just a bit. If you would go to off 52-53 there would be no rubbing problem
...got my car lowerd with a kw v3, so without aftermarket coilover off 50 should also work

No but I just bought some coupe rims for the next winter season. Rear is 10,5 Off 57, with 5mm spacers that should work. front is 9,0 off 35 that would also work..you could take 10mm so that it looks better
